1. 08 Sep, 2003 5 commits
  2. 06 Sep, 2003 6 commits
    • Matthias Clasen's avatar
      Fix a C99ism. (#121640, Josh Beam) · e8c93d56
      Matthias Clasen authored
      2003-09-07  Matthias Clasen  <maclas@gmx.de>
      
      	* gtk/gtkuimanager.c (update_node): Fix a C99ism.  (#121640,
      	Josh Beam)
      
      	Fixes for accelerator handling during (un)merging:
      
      	* gtk/gtkuimanager.c (update_node): Move setting info-action
      	after the switch, since the old action is needed in some cases.
      	In cases of proxy type mismatch, disconnect the old proxy from
      	the old action.
      
      	* gtk/gtkaction.c (remove_proxy): Renamed from
      	gtk_action_remove_proxy(). Move unsetting of the accelerator
      	here from disconnect_proxy() in order to catch all cases of
      	removing a proxy.
      	(gtk_action_disconnect_proxy): Fix logic in g_return_if_fail()
      	to fail if proxy isn't a proxy of action.
      e8c93d56
    • Pablo Saratxaga's avatar
      Added Uzbek files · cc4935c0
      Pablo Saratxaga authored
      cc4935c0
    • Matthias Clasen's avatar
      Make disconnect work for toolitems. · 0a79e5e3
      Matthias Clasen authored
      2003-09-07  Matthias Clasen  <maclas@gmx.de>
      
      	* gtk/gtkaction.c (disconnect_proxy): Make disconnect work
      	for toolitems.
      0a79e5e3
    • Matthias Clasen's avatar
      Disconnect from prev_action, not from action. (Fix by David Hampton) · 7db084ec
      Matthias Clasen authored
      2003-09-06  Matthias Clasen  <maclas@gmx.de>
      
      	* gtk/gtkaction.c (gtk_action_connect_proxy): Disconnect from
      	prev_action, not from action.  (Fix by David Hampton)
      7db084ec
    • Mugurel Tudor's avatar
      *** empty log message *** · aae31648
      Mugurel Tudor authored
      aae31648
    • Federico Mena Quintero's avatar
      New function. (create_directory_tree): New function. (create_file_list): · a9eaa49d
      Federico Mena Quintero authored
      2003-09-05  Federico Mena Quintero  <federico@ximian.com>
      
      	* gtkfilechooserimpldefault.c (create_filter): New function.
      	(create_directory_tree): New function.
      	(create_file_list): New function.
      	(create_filename_entry): New function.
      	(gtk_file_chooser_impl_default_constructor): Use the functions
      	above rather than creating the whole file chooser megawidget here,
      	for readability.  This will also let us rearrange the user
      	interface more easily.
      a9eaa49d
  3. 05 Sep, 2003 1 commit
  4. 04 Sep, 2003 7 commits
    • Matthias Clasen's avatar
      Test buttons and toggle buttons as proxies. · 9ae676b0
      Matthias Clasen authored
      2003-09-04  Matthias Clasen  <maclas@gmx.de>
      
      	* tests/testmerge.c: Test buttons and toggle buttons as proxies.
      
      	* gtk/gtktoggleaction.c (connect_proxy):
      	(gtk_toggle_action_real_toggled): Support toggle buttons as proxies. Note
      	that a "draw_as_radio" property is needed for check buttons similar to
      	check menu items, in order to fully support button proxies for radio actions.
      
      	* gtk/gtkaction.c (connect_proxy): Allow buttons as proxies.
      9ae676b0
    • Matthias Clasen's avatar
      Test gtk_ui_manager_add_ui(). · 02a963e1
      Matthias Clasen authored
      2003-09-04  Matthias Clasen  <maclas@gmx.de>
      
      	* tests/testmerge.c (toggle_dynamic): Test gtk_ui_manager_add_ui().
      
      	* gtk/gtkuimanager.h: Add GtkUIManagerItemType enum which is needed for the
      	'type' argument of gtk_ui_manager_add_ui().
      
      	* gtk/gtkuimanager.[hc] (gtk_ui_manager_add_ui): Add 'type' and 'top' arguments
      	to make this function as powerful as the XML methods of adding UI.  (#120647)
      
      	* gtk/gtk-sections.txt: Add GtkUIManagerItemType.
      02a963e1
    • Kristian Rietveld's avatar
      Merge from stable. · 563746c7
      Kristian Rietveld authored
      Thu Sep  4 19:11:23 2003  Kristian Rietveld  <kris@gtk.org>
      
      	Merge from stable.
      
      	* docs/RELEASE-HOWTO: updates.
      563746c7
    • Matthias Clasen's avatar
      Use "position" instead of "pos". · 6c227b5a
      Matthias Clasen authored
      	* tests/merge-2.ui: Use "position" instead of "pos".
      
      	* gtk/gtkuimanager.c (start_element_handler): No need
      	to be terse: Change the name of the "pos" attribute
      	to "position".
      
      	* gtk/tmpl/gtkuimanager.sgml: Change the name of the "pos"
      	attribute to "position".
      6c227b5a
    • Matthias Clasen's avatar
      Doc tweaks. · 0a163c7f
      Matthias Clasen authored
      0a163c7f
    • Matthias Clasen's avatar
      Un-prefix GtkUIManagerNodeType and GtkUIManagerNode to shorten the names · e4dbc17a
      Matthias Clasen authored
      	* gtk/gtkuimanager.c: Un-prefix GtkUIManagerNodeType and
      	GtkUIManagerNode to shorten the names and to make the
      	GTK_UI_MANAGER_<TYPE> names available for a public enum.
      e4dbc17a
    • Matthias Clasen's avatar
      Various doc tweaks. · e6a8aa11
      Matthias Clasen authored
      2003-09-04  Matthias Clasen  <maclas@gmx.de>
      
      	* gtk/gtkuimanager.c: Various doc tweaks.
      
      	* gtk/gtkuimanager.c (start_element_handler):
      	(end_element_handler): Improve error reporting.
      e6a8aa11
  5. 03 Sep, 2003 10 commits
    • Kristian Rietveld's avatar
      Merge from stable. · bc61e723
      Kristian Rietveld authored
      Wed Sep  3 23:18:17 2003  Kristian Rietveld  <kris@gtk.org>
      
      	Merge from stable.
      
      	* gtk/gtkmenu.c (gtk_menu_real_move_scroll): for the END case,
      	use end_position - page_size instead of G_MAXINT, since
      	gtk_menu_scroll_to doesn't CLAMP anymore internally. (Fixes #121237,
      	reported by Havoc Pennington).
      bc61e723
    • Owen Taylor's avatar
      Remove excess check that was breaking with current GObject. · 00893711
      Owen Taylor authored
      Wed Sep  3 16:38:59 2003  Owen Taylor  <otaylor@redhat.com>
      
              * glib-interface-propreties-0.5.patch: Remove excess
              check that was breaking with current GObject.
      
              * gtkfilechooser.c (gtk_file_chooser_class_init):
              use the new ability to have a class_init function for
              interfaces to avoid the ugly static gboolean initialized
              hack.
      00893711
    • Kristian Rietveld's avatar
      Merge from stable. · 1c9d02b4
      Kristian Rietveld authored
      Wed Sep  3 21:58:03 2003  Kristian Rietveld  <kris@gtk.org>
      
      	Merge from stable.
      
      	* gtk/gtkiconfactory.c (cached_icon_free): if icon->style != NULL,
      	unref it. (Fixes memleak, patch from Kjartan Maraas).
      1c9d02b4
    • Kristian Rietveld's avatar
      brooooooooken pipe. · eccc733f
      Kristian Rietveld authored
      eccc733f
    • Kristian Rietveld's avatar
      big patch from Kjartan Maraas to fix numerous typos. · 9538b6e5
      Kristian Rietveld authored
      Wed Sep  3 21:38:26 2003  Kristian Rietveld  <kris@gtk.org>
      
      	* gdk/Makefile.am, gdk/linux-fb/gdkfbmanager.c, gdk/x11/gdkcolor-x11.c,
      	gdk-pixbuf/io-gif.c, gtk/Makefile.am, gtk/gtkcalendar.c,
      	gtk/gtkclist.c, gtk/gtkctree.c, gtk/gtkdnd.c, gtk/gtkentry.c,
      	gtk/gtkhandlebox.c, gtk/gtkitemfactory.c, gtk/gtkmenu.c,
      	gtk/gtknotebook.c, gtk/gtkrange.c, gtk/gtkrc.h, gtk/gtktree.c,
      	gtk/gtktypeutils.h: big patch from Kjartan Maraas
      	to fix numerous typos.
      9538b6e5
    • Owen Taylor's avatar
      Update. · a653ea3a
      Owen Taylor authored
      Wed Sep  3 15:32:26 2003  Owen Taylor  <otaylor@redhat.com>
      
              * glib-interface-propreties-{0.4,0.5}.patch: Update.
      
              * gtkfilechooserutils.c prop-editor.c: Update for
              newer interface-properties API.
      a653ea3a
    • cinamod's avatar
      use tooltip color, font · 1ff4c35f
      cinamod authored
      1ff4c35f
    • BST 2003 Tony Gale's avatar
      Forgot to update the FAQ date from previous commit · abc6ebe0
      BST 2003 Tony Gale authored
      Wed Sep  3 17:50:00 BST 2003 Tony Gale <gale@gtk.org>
      
       Forgot to update the FAQ date from previous commit
      abc6ebe0
    • BST 2003  Tony Gale's avatar
      Correct compile line for threads example. · 47259001
      BST 2003 Tony Gale authored
      Wed Sep  3 17:38:01 BST 2003  Tony Gale <gale@gtk.org>
      
              * docs/faq/gtk-faq.sgml: Correct compile line for threads example.
      47259001
    • Federico Mena Quintero's avatar
      Removed the "extra widget" bit, implemented with the following: · 36dfea8e
      Federico Mena Quintero authored
      2003-09-03  Federico Mena Quintero  <federico@ximian.com>
      
      	* TODO: Removed the "extra widget" bit, implemented with the
      	following:
      
      	* gtkfilechooser.h: Added gtk_file_chooser_{set,get}_extra_widget().
      
      	* gtkfilechooser.c (gtk_file_chooser_base_init): Install an
      	"extra-widget" interface property.
      	(gtk_file_chooser_set_extra_widget): Implemented.
      	(gtk_file_chooser_get_extra_widget): Implemented.
      
      	* gtkfilechooserutils.h (GtkFileChooserProp): Added
      	GTK_FILE_CHOOSER_PROP_EXTRA_WIDGET.
      
      	* gtkfilechooserutils.c (_gtk_file_chooser_install_properties):
      	Added the "extra-widget" property.
      
      	* gtkfilechooserimpldefault.c (struct _GtkFileChooserImplDefault):
      	Added an extra_widget field.
      	(gtk_file_chooser_impl_default_set_property): Handle the
      	"extra-widget" property.
      	(gtk_file_chooser_impl_default_get_property): Likewise.
      	(set_preview_widget): Fix the call gtk_container_remove().  Also,
      	we don't need to ref/sink/unref the preview widget, as that gets
      	already done by container_add/remove.
      	(set_extra_widget): New utility function.
      
      	* testfilechooser.c (main): Add an extra widget.
      36dfea8e
  6. 02 Sep, 2003 5 commits
    • Tor Lillqvist's avatar
      Don't call CloseHandle() on the HMODULE returned from GetModuleHandle(). · fafe735f
      Tor Lillqvist authored
      2003-09-02  Tor Lillqvist  <tml@iki.fi>
      
      	* gdk/win32/gdkdisplay-win32.c (gdk_display_open): Don't call
      	CloseHandle() on the HMODULE returned from GetModuleHandle().
      	Didn't cause any harm, but didn't do anything useful either. When
      	running a GTK+ program under MS's debugger, the CloseHandle() call
      	would cause a "first-chance exception" in ntdll.dll to show up.
      	(The exception is caught appropriately if you let it proceed, but
      	it confuses the person using the debugger). Thanks to Bruce
      	Hochstetler for noticing.
      fafe735f
    • cinamod's avatar
      respect boldness and italic · 15dbb7c9
      cinamod authored
      15dbb7c9
    • Federico Mena Quintero's avatar
      s/nonexistant/nonexistent Likewise. Likewise. Likewise. · cc4836c9
      Federico Mena Quintero authored
      2003-09-02  Federico Mena Quintero  <federico@ximian.com>
      
      	* gtkfilesystem.h: s/nonexistant/nonexistent
      	* gtkfilesystem.c: Likewise.
      	* gtkfilesystemgnomevfs.c: Likewise.
      	* gtkfilesystemunix.c: Likewise.
      
      2003-08-27  Federico Mena Quintero  <federico@ximian.com>
      
      	* README: The required GtkTreeView patches are already on CVS.
      	Removed the part that mentions them.
      cc4836c9
    • cinamod's avatar
      fix build · 4a32a347
      cinamod authored
      4a32a347
    • Kristian Rietveld's avatar
      Merge from stable. · e5efd714
      Kristian Rietveld authored
      Tue Sep  2 21:01:19 2003  Kristian Rietveld  <kris@gtk.org>
      
      	Merge from stable.
      
      	* gtk/gtktreeview.c (gtk_tree_view_button_press): revert the change
      	to only select when button 1 is pressed introduced in the fix of
      	bug #120187.
      e5efd714
  7. 01 Sep, 2003 6 commits